TRow, I have 3 OS on my system.
HDA1 - Win98 Fat16, HDA2 - WinXP NTFS, HDA3 - extended partition, HDA4 - Linux Ext2 (my Knoppix install).
I don't have a boot manager.
In Windows I use Partition Magic 7.0 for partition management and resizing.
Right click on the partiton you want to set active, select the LAST item in the popup menu - Advanced
In the Advanced submenu select 'Set active'
Reboot.
In Linux I use QTParted to do the same thing, but when you initially reboot to Windows, you will see the Debian boot management menu. Using PM7.0 again to select another Windows boot partition will clear the Debian menu.

It is designed for Linux. There was *NOT* a specific Linux only release. The Linux installers shipped with the Windows version.
Patches for UT2004 are on http://www.icculus.org/
As far as I could find, the only Unreal series game that won't run in Linux is the disgrace to the Unreal name - Unreal II ; The Awakening.
